Stock up, stock down following the Jets' preseason win vs. the Packers

Stock report following the Jets' 30-10 preseason win vs. the Packers.

The New York Jets got after it in Week 1 NFL preseason by beating the Green Bay Packers in 30-10 fashion.

Stocks of players always go up and down after games, even more so in the exhibition season as players are vying to make the final roster.

With that, here is Jets Wire's stock report following the team's preseason win over the Packers:

Stock down: Head coach Aaron Glenn

Congrats to Glenn on winning his first game as a head coach. While his team had plenty of positives to be found in their effort, 10 penalties for 91 yards. A few were personal fouls and that is very ugly.

Stock up: QB Justin Fields

It was only one series, but Fields looked like a starting QB. He was 3-for-4 passing for 42 yards and went on to rush in a touchdown on the first drive of his Jets career.

Stock up: Offensive line

Fields and the Jets overall offense against the Packers did well because the offensive line played great. The Packers did not record a sack and there was positive play on the ground.

Stock up: DT Jay Tufele

Tufele stole the show from Fields. The defensive lineman had a massive outing, recording 1.5 sacks, a tackle for loss, two QB hits and scored on a fumble recovery.

Stock up: DE Leonard Taylor III

Tufele had the touchdown thanks to Taylor.

Taylor recorded the strip-sack which allowed Tufele to scoop the ball up in the end zone and score.

Stock down: RB Breece Hall

While the Jets offensive line did play well, Hall did not do great in his limited touches. He only had nine yards on three carries with no catches in the passing game.

Meanwhile, Braelon Allen stood out by averaging 4.1 yards per carry on eight rushes.

Stock down: WR Allen Lazard

As a veteran, Lazard has not stood out much at all this summer. While he did have two catches for 17 yards against his former team, Lazard sustained a shoulder injury which does not help preseason stock at all.
